There are usually two types of service during the month; Holy Communion on the second Sunday, led by a priest, and Sunday Worship led by members of our home team on the fourth Sunday. The service of Holy communion is traditional and can be followed by reading the Order of Service provided, which is common to all the churches in the Saffron Walden and Villages Ministry, all part of the Church of England.

Sunday worship on the fourth Sunday is a lovely and inclusive service, where some of us take a role in leading and giving a themed talk. Others may read or tell us about their favourite hymns. This is often in the South or Lady Chapel, which is both bright and intimate, and where we find God together. Here we follow a printed service sheet and other books. This service is normally preceded by a breakfast in the church rooms, to which all are invited. Both services have tea and biscuits served afterwards.
